International graduate admissions: deadlines
Submit a complete application form
To be eligible for assessment, your application must be complete and submitted before:
-
the deadline for the programme to which you are applying; or
-
the earliest deadline, if you apply to several programmes with different deadlines; or
-
the deadline for the scholarship you are applying for, where applicable.

Deadlines for the Master's programmes
Admissions for the 2020 intake open mid-October.
Closing date: 1 March 2020.
Admission decisions
For the Master Journalism and International Affairs, the specific deadline is 2 February 2020. All the applications will be reviewed after this date.
For all the other Master's programmes, the admission decision date depends on the date the complete application was submitted (including completed recommendations). You will know our decision before:
- 20 December 2019 if you submitted your application before 3 November 2019
- 14 February 2020 if you submitted your application between 4 November and 15 December 2019
- 15 March 2020 if you submitted your application between 16 December and 12 January 2020
- 17 April 2020 if you submitted your application between 13 January and 16 February 2020
- 29 May 2020 if you submitted your application between 17 February and 1 March 2020
Please note: if you submit an incomplete application, it will not be reviewed. You will be able to apply again next year.

Useful tips
- Apply as early as possible: Do not wait until the very last day to submit your application. Admission decisions are announced on a rolling basis, so the earlier you submit your application, the sooner you will be notified of Sciences Po's decision.
- Anticipate: As soon as you start your application, make sure to gather all the information required, for example: request official documents, choose and contact your referees, take your language tests and check your visa status.
- Joint Master in Journalism and International Affairs: There are no rolling admissions for this joint master's. Applications will be reviewed after the submission deadline (2 February 2020).
